/* ????? ?????????????? ????? RGB (????? / ???????): 
???????: 0, 160, 226 / 
?????????: 255, 167, 0 / 255, 255, 127, 0;
*/

body {
  min-width:1100px;
  background: #0F0F0F;
  color: #AFAFAF;
  font-family: Lucida Grande,Helvetica,Arial,Verdana,sans-serif;
  
  font-style: normal;
  margin: 0px 0px 0px 0px;
}

#head {
	min-width:1100px;
	height:120px;
	background: #000 url("img/body-background.jpg");
	border: none;
	border-top: 1px solid #353535;
	padding: 10 60px 10 60px;
	margin:0px;
}

#head img {
border:none
}

#logo {
float:left; 
margin: 10px 0px 0px 83px;
border:none;
width:236px;
height:98px
}

table {
	width: 100%;
	border: none;
	vertical-align:top;
}

a {
  color: white;
  text-decoration: none
}
a:hover {
  color: #ddd
}

h1, h2, h3, h4{
  color: white;
  font-family: Calibri, Lucida Grande,Helvetica,Arial,Verdana,serif;
  font-style:normal;
  line-height: 1em;
  
  }
  
h1{
  font-size: 1.5em;
  margin-bottom: 0.5em;
}

h2{
  font-size: 1.3em;
  margin-bottom: 0.5em;
}

h3{
  font-size: 1.2em;
  margin-bottom: 0.5em;
}



/* карта сайта */
#sitemap {
float:right; 
margin-right:83px;
border:none
}


#contentPad {
    min-width:1000px;
	background: #000 url("img/body-background.jpg");
	border: none;
	padding: 0 60px 0 30px;
	width:*
}

/* логотип */

#content_main {
	font-size: 90%; 
	padding: 10px 0px 40px 10px;
	float:left;
	width:68%
}

#content {
	font-size: 90%; 
	padding: 10px 0px 40px 10px;
	float:left;
	width:73%
}
#content_home {
	font-size: 90%; padding-left:41px; padding-right:42px; padding-top:41px; padding-bottom:15px
}

#content li {
line-height: 1.5em;
}

#content img {
border:#CCCCCC solid 2px;
}


/*  вертикальное меню  */
#menucarrier {
	font-size: 90%; 
	width: 200px;
	float:right;
	clear:right
		}
		
#menucarrier  ul{		
list-style: none;
text-align:left;
padding-left: 0px;
margin-left:0px
}

#menucarrier_main {
	font-size: 90%; 
	width: 300px;
	float:right;
	clear:right
		}

#navweb, #navphoto {
line-height: 1.4em;
}

#navweb, #navphoto img {
    border:none
}

#navweb #actweb {
	color: rgb(204, 255, 153);
	}

#sub {
padding-left:20px;
}

#navphoto #actphoto {
	color: rgb(255, 204, 153);
}		

.links {
text-align:center;
line-height:1.4;
}		
		
/* меню навигации */
#nav {
	float:right; 
    margin-right:83px;
    border:none;
	list-style: none;
	font-size: 90%;
}


#nav li {
	float: right;
	padding: 15px;
	margin: 0 0 0 2px;
}
	
#nav #actweb {
	background: #99cc33;
	color:#333333
}


#nav #actphoto {
	background: #ffcc66;
	color:#333333
	}		
		
/* основной блок */

	
.inner {
	padding: 30px 30px 40px 30px
}

#innerhead {
padding: 0px;
background:#333333; 
border-top:1px solid #434343
}

#innerhead h1, h2, h3, h4{
color: #FFFFFF;
padding: 0px 30px 0px 30px}

#innerhead p {
padding: 0px 30px 0px 30px}

#innerarticle {
padding: 0 0 5px 0;
background:#cccccc; 
border-top:1px solid #FFFFFF;
color:#333333;
font-style:italic
} 

#innertext {
padding: 10px 30px 10px 20px;
background:#FFFFFF;
border-top:1px solid #999999;
color:#333333;
font-style:normal
}


#innertext a{
color: #669900;
text-decoration:underline
}

#innertext a:hover {
  color:#666666;
font-style:normal
}


#innertext h2, h3{
color: #669900;
}

.text-green-normal {
  color: #99cc33;
}


.text-green {
  color: #99cc33;
  font-size:large;
  font-style:italic;
}

.text-green-large {
  color: #99cc33;
  font-size:xx-large;
  font-style:italic;
  line-height: 0.8em;
}

.text-yellow {
  color: rgb(255, 204, 102);
  font-size:large;
  font-style:italic;
}

.text-yellow-normal {
  color: rgb(255, 204, 102)
}



#signature {
line-height: 1.2em;
padding-left: 20px;
text-align:left
}

/* галерея */
#gallery img {
  border 1px solid color:#FFFFFF;
  width:200;
  height:175;
} 

/* Подвал */
#footer {
  z-index: 0;
  border: 1px 1px 0 1px solid #353535;
  padding: 10px 70px 10px 70px;
  font-size: 80%;
  color: #555;
  line-height: 1.0em;
  background-color: #0F0F0F;
  margin-top: 0px;
  clear:both
}
#footer a{
  color: #666
}
#footer a:hover{
  color: #ddd
}
